Why Healthy Movement Matters

The human body is designed to move. Proper joint function and coordinated muscle function are essential for walking, lifting, bending, reaching, and stretching. The body often compensates for spinal joint dysfunction by placing additional stress on the muscles and surrounding tissues.

Over time, these compensatory patterns can contribute to:

  • Neck pain and recurring back pain
  • Joint stiffness
  • Muscle tightness
  • Poor posture
  • Reduced flexibility
  • Limited range of motion
  • Decreased physical performance

Restoring normal movement helps reduce unnecessary stress and promotes healthy movement throughout the body.

The Role of Chiropractic Care

Chiropractic care focuses on improving spinal alignment, joint mobility, and overall mobility. Chiropractors identify and treat movement restrictions that contribute to pain and reduced mobility rather than simply masking symptoms.

A comprehensive chiropractic evaluation often includes an assessment of:

  • Spinal alignment
  • Joint mobility
  • Posture
  • Muscle balance
  • Movement patterns
  • Areas of nerve irritation

This evaluation allows chiropractors to create a personalized treatment plan that addresses the root cause of dysfunction rather than simply managing symptoms.

Supporting the Nervous System

The spine protects the spinal cord, which serves as the primary communication pathway between the brain and the rest of the body. When normal movement is restricted in the spinal joints, the surrounding tissues can become irritated, contributing to pain and reduced mobility.

Improving spinal mobility helps reduce stress on surrounding structures while promoting better coordination between muscles and joints to support healthy nervous system function.

Preventing Future Problems

Early identification and treatment of movement restrictions can help reduce the risk of chronic pain and future injuries. Poor posture, repetitive movements, and prolonged sitting place additional stress on the spine and surrounding muscles.

Regular chiropractic care, combined with stretching, strengthening exercises, and ergonomic improvements, can help maintain healthy movement patterns and support spinal health over the long term.
